Summer

Summer is the peak tourist season in Magnolia in Waco, with temperatures often reaching the mid-90s (Fahrenheit). The heat can be intense, but the city’s many parks and outdoor spaces offer respite from the sun. Summer is also the best time to visit the city’s many festivals and events, such as the Waco Mammoth Festival and the Waco Jazz Festival.

Fall

Fall is a great time to visit Magnolia in Waco, with mild temperatures and fewer crowds. The foliage is also beautiful, with the changing leaves of the trees creating a picturesque backdrop for your visit. Fall is also a great time to visit the city’s many museums and cultural attractions, such as the Dr Pepper Museum and the Waco Suspension Bridge.

Winter

Winter is the coolest season in Magnolia in Waco, with temperatures often dipping into the 40s and 50s (Fahrenheit). While it may be chilly, winter is a great time to visit the city’s many indoor attractions, such as the Waco Convention Center and the Magnolia Market.

Spring

Spring is a great time to visit Magnolia in Waco, with mild temperatures and blooming flowers. The city’s many parks and outdoor spaces are also a great place to visit, with the beautiful scenery and wildlife viewing opportunities. Magnolia Market

Magnolia Market is a popular destination in Waco, offering a wide range of products, including home decor, furniture, and gifts. The market is also a great place to visit for a unique shopping experience, with its rustic charm and friendly staff.

Dr Pepper Museum

The Dr Pepper Museum is a must-visit attraction in Waco, offering a unique look at the history of the iconic soft drink. The museum features exhibits on the history of Dr Pepper, as well as a gift shop where you can purchase souvenirs.

Waco Suspension Bridge

The Waco Suspension Bridge is a historic landmark in Waco, offering stunning views of the Brazos River. The bridge is also a great place to visit for a romantic stroll or a family outing.
